007.15 A Mill on the side of
"N. Calder Water" used principally
For grinding oats, beans,peas,
& Barley, A course kind of
flour is sometimes made here
but, upon the authority of
the manager, the principal
business is used in grinding corn.
It is the property of Miss
Muirhead of "Bredisholm", &
and is wrought by Mr. James Muirhead
of "Langloan Mill". A new
Tram Road has been recently
made south of this mill. It
crosses the "Water" by a modern
Bridge. A new Stone has
also been made, since slung
over the"N. Calder Water", close to
the Tram Road Bridge, by which
the course of the Parish Road
has been altered to that
shown as supplied by
Examiner.
